A biography of the royal sisters from their birth to the parting of their royal ways - with Elizabeth now Queen and the mother of two infants, and Margaret thwarted in her desire to marry Peter Townsend. The book concentrates on the relationship between the two sisters and the strains and rewards of their position (though with very different expectations) as members of the Royal Family.
